All uniformed officers who deal
with the public will wear name
badges and carry an Identity
Card.
-
Personal and business information
disclosed to us will be kept
confidential.
-
Clearance of consignments will be
withheld only after explaining the
reasons for the same and
will give you full opportunity to explain before passing any final order.
-
Assesses in the small scale sector
will be visited only with proper
authority from senior officers.
-
Your tax compliance record will be
recognized and security/surety will
not be insisted upon.
-
Passengers can walk through customs
expecting courtesy, fairness and
consideration.
-
Baggage of international passengers
will be opened only after explaining
the reasons and in
their presence.
-
We will help in repacking baggage
if we have made you unpack them.
-
We will explain the reasons if we
need to search you and offer our own
search before it.
-
Investigations and penalty
proceedings will be initiated only
after senior officers of the
Department are satisfied that prima facie evidence exists.
The investigating officer will ---
- explain the legal provisions and
your rights and obligations.
- seek confirmatory information by
personal contact.
-
No seized document will be withheld
beyond 60 days except where they are
to be relied upon
in departmental proceedings.
-
We will provide full information
about appeal procedures and the
authorities with whom
appeals can be filled.
-
We will continually consult all
commercial interests while reviewing
our policies and provide
timely publicity of all changes in the law or procedures.
-
Every possible assistance will be
rendered by the Public Relations
Officer in the Divisional
Office/Commissionerate Office/Custom
House (the name and telephone
number of the Public
Relations Officer will be prominently displayed at such offices by
providing all relevant
information and details of procedures as may be required.

We shall acknowledge declarations,
intimations, applications, returns
and all communications
on the spot and in any case within 7 days of their receipt.
-
Respond
to all communication within 15
working days of its receipt.
-
Settle
any disputes relating to
declarations or assessments within
10 working days of receipt
of your written or oral explanation.
-
Refund
amounts due to you within 48 hours
of the export of the goods in case
of electronic
declarations and 15 days in case of paper declarations.
-
Release,
where your declaration relating to
any consignment is complete and
consignment is
complete and correct --
-in case of exports, within 8 hours
of filling an electronic declaration
or within 24 hours of filing
a paper declaration.
-in case of imports, within 24
hours of filling an electronic
declaration or within 72 hours of
filing a paper declaration.
-
Complete excise registration
formalities within 48 hours of
receiving your application.
-
Return to you the input duty
documents on which MODVAT credit has
been availed of within 7
days of your submission.
-
Complete examination and clearance
of your export consignment at your
factory premises, whenever you seek
such a facility, within 8 hours of
receiving intimation.
-
Give you 15 days advance intimation
before we undertake audit of your
records.
-
In case of likely or inevitable
delay in decision making or when an
issue is disputed, we shall
promptly communicate the reasons
on our own initiative.
